DEV Community

Tech Insights With Millie
Tech Insights With Millie

Posted on

Eliminating Inventory Inaccuracies in Growing Supply Chains: A Practical Framework for Real-Time Visibility

1. Problem Introduction
Inventory inaccuracy is one of the most persistent and expensive problems in modern supply chains. For startups and growing tech-driven businesses, even small discrepancies between recorded and actual stock levels can lead to stockouts, delayed shipments, production halts, and dissatisfied customers.

In early-stage operations, spreadsheets and basic inventory tools may be sufficient. But as order volume increases, warehouses expand, and multi-channel sales are introduced, manual processes and disconnected systems begin to fail.

The core problem is not just inventory tracking — it is the lack of real-time visibility and synchronization across systems.

This article outlines a practical, technology-driven framework to reduce inventory inaccuracies and build a scalable, reliable supply chain foundation.

2. Detailed Solution
Improving inventory accuracy requires both process discipline and technical architecture. Below is a structured approach that developers and operations teams can implement.

Step 1: Identify the Root Causes of Inventory Drift
Before introducing new tools, understand why inaccuracies occur. Common causes include:

  • Manual data entry errors
  • Delayed system updates
  • Unrecorded returns or damaged goods
  • Multi-warehouse synchronization issues
  • Inconsistent SKU definitions
  • Lack of integration between sales and warehouse systems

Conduct a short audit:

  • Compare physical counts to system records.
  • Identify discrepancies by product category.
  • Track when and where mismatches occur.

Quantifying the problem allows you to design targeted solutions instead of applying generic fixes.

Step 2: Implement Real-Time Data Synchronization
One of the biggest contributors to inventory errors is delayed system updates.

Modern supply chains should use:

  • Event-driven architecture
  • Webhooks or message queues
  • API-based integrations between systems

When a sale occurs, inventory must update immediately across:

  • Warehouse management systems (WMS)
  • ERP systems
  • E-commerce platforms
  • Accounting software Using message brokers or real-time API calls ensures that inventory changes propagate instantly rather than in scheduled batch updates.

Step 3: Introduce Automated Stock Validation
Automated validation mechanisms reduce reliance on manual oversight.

Examples include:

  • Threshold alerts when stock falls below minimum levels
  • Automated reconciliation between warehouse scans and system records
  • Daily automated discrepancy reports
  • Exception logging for unusual transaction patterns

Barcoding and RFID scanning further reduce human error by ensuring each movement is recorded digitally at the point of action.

Step 4: Standardize SKU and Data Structures
Data inconsistency is often overlooked.

Ensure:

  • Uniform SKU naming conventions
  • Consistent product identifiers across platforms
  • Centralized master product database
  • Version-controlled product data updates

When different systems interpret products differently, synchronization becomes unreliable. A centralized product data model eliminates ambiguity.

Step 5: Enable Cycle Counting Instead of Annual Audits
Waiting for annual stock audits allows discrepancies to accumulate.

Instead, implement cycle counting:

  • Rotate product categories for regular checks
  • Prioritize high-value or fast-moving items
  • Compare counts weekly or monthly

Cycle counting helps detect systematic errors early and reduces operational shock during major audits.

Step 6: Build Monitoring Dashboards
Inventory visibility should not rely on manual reporting.

Develop dashboards that track:

  • Real-time stock levels
  • Order fulfillment rates
  • Stockout frequency
  • Inventory turnover ratio
  • Shrinkage trends

Data visualization enables leadership to make proactive decisions instead of reacting to shortages.

4. Practical Example
Consider a growing D2C brand operating across two warehouses and three online marketplaces.

Initially, inventory updates were processed every four hours using batch synchronization. During high sales periods, this delay caused overselling, resulting in canceled orders and customer complaints.

After restructuring their architecture:

  1. Real-time APIs replaced batch synchronization. Barcode scanning was implemented for inbound and outbound goods.
  2. A centralized SKU database was created.
  3. Automated discrepancy alerts were configured.
  4. Weekly cycle counts were introduced.
  5. Within three months:
  • Inventory accuracy improved from 92% to 99.4%.
  • Stockouts dropped significantly.
  • Customer satisfaction scores increased.
  • Manual reconciliation time was reduced by 60%.

The improvement was not driven by one tool but by a coordinated system of real-time data flow, standardized processes, and proactive monitoring.

5. Conclusion
Inventory accuracy is not simply an operational metric — it is a competitive advantage. As startups and tech-driven businesses scale, disconnected systems and manual processes become unsustainable.

By identifying root causes, implementing real-time synchronization, standardizing data structures, automating validation, and enabling continuous monitoring, businesses can eliminate costly discrepancies and build resilient supply chain operations.

Technology alone does not solve the problem — but the right architecture, combined with disciplined processes, creates transparency and control.

At supplychaintek.com, we help businesses implement solutions like this — learn more here: https://supplychaintek.com

Top comments (0)